GENERAL DESCRIPTION
The EVAL-ADM3062EEBZ and EVAL-ADM3062EEB1Z allow
quick and easy evaluation of the ADM3062E 500 kbps, RS-485
transceiver with standard MSOP and LFCSP footprints, respec-
tively. The evaluation boards allow the use of input and output
functions without external components. Screw terminal blocks
provide convenient connections for power and ground, digital
input and output, and RS-485 signals. The evaluation boards
can be powered by a standard configurable bench power supply
within a 3.0 V to 5.5 V range.
Figure 2. EVAL-ADM3062EEB1Z Evaluation Board
The EVAL-ADM3062EEBZ evaluation board has a footprint for
the ADM3062EBRMZ half-duplex RS-485 transceiver in a 10-lead
MSOP package. The EVAL-ADM3062EEB1Z evaluation board
has a footprint for the ADM3062EBCPZ half-duplex RS-485
transceiver in a 10-lead LFCSP package.
Complete specifications for the ADM3062E are provided in the
ADM3062E data sheet and must be consulted in conjunction with
this user guide when using the evaluation board.

The EVAL-ADM3062EEBZ and EVAL-ADM3062EEB1Z
evaluation boards are powered by connecting a 3.0 V or 5.5 V
power supply to the J1 screw terminals at the top of the evaluation
board for the ADM3062E VCC pin and GND pin. A 10 µF
decoupling capacitor, C3, is fitted at the connector between VCC
and GND. The VCC pin of the RS-485 transceiver is fitted with a
100 nF decoupling capacitor, C1, with a second footprint for an
optional additional capacitor, C2. The VIO pin can be connected
with VCC or a separate 1.8 V power supply.
The EVAL-ADM3062EEBZ and EVAL-ADM3062EEB1Z
evaluation boards include footprints for termination resistors,
RT1 and RT2, as well as pull-up and pull-down resistors, R1 and
R2. Termination resistors of 120 Ω are fitted to the evaluation
board; these resistors can be removed or replaced with a different
value resistor as needed. Inserting both LK3 and LK4 adds a
60 Ω load to the RS-485 driver.
Biasing Resistors for Bus Idle Fail-Safe
Although the ADM3062E has a built in receiver fail-safe for the
bus idle condition, there are footprints on the evaluation boards
for fitting the R2 pull-up resistor to the VCC pin on A, as well as
the R1 pull-down resistor to GND on B. These resistors can be
fitted if the user is connecting to other devices that require such
external biasing resistors on the bus. The exact value required
for a 200 mV minimum differential voltage in the bus idle con-
dition depends on the supply voltage (for example, 960 Ω for
3.3 V and 1440 Ω for 5 V).

HALF-DUPLEX, RS-485 TRANSCEIVERS POINT TO
POINT TEST
A point to point test can be set up with either two EVAL-
ADM3062EEBZ evaluation boards or two EVAL-ADM3062EEB1Z
evaluation boards. Figure 4 shows two half-duplex evaluation
boards in this configuration. Note that the positions of LK1 and
LK2 on each evaluation board enable the driver on one evaluation
board and the receiver on the other evaluation board. Remove
LK4 from the EVAL-ADM3062EEBZ or EVAL-ADM3062EEB1Z
evaluation board to ensure both ends of the bus have only a 120 Ω
load. Differential signals on the bus are monitored with an
oscilloscope, as well as with the DI pin and RO pin of the
ADM3062E.

The EVAL-ADM3062EEBZ and EVAL-ADM3062EEB1Z
evaluation boards are tested to achieve protection against
IEC 61000-4-2 electrostatic discharge (ESD) to 12 kV (contact),
and 12 kV (air gap) on the RS-485 A and B bus pins.
8A
10%
The IEC 61000-4-2 ESD standard describes testing using two
coupling methods known as contact discharge and air gap
discharge. Contact discharge implies a direct contact between the
discharge gun and the equipment under test (EUT).

During air discharge testing, the charged electrode of the discharge
gun is moved toward the EUT until a discharge occurs as an arc
across the air gap. The discharge gun does not make direct contact
with the EUT.
